Marsh equipment is ideally suited for wetland and unstable terrain applications. These machines can work in areas where a human cannot even walk. The large footprint of the machine exerts the least amount of pressure per square inch possible. While the machines are amphibious, it is not recommended to operate the machine in full floatation mode. The floatation capabilities of the machine come in handy for crossing waterways or transporting the machine down rivers. Our machines float with 20% or more freeboard. Since these machines are buoyant vehicles, the danger of slipping into a bog or bottomless marsh is nonexistent.
